+## Convert to SQL required string format
+def ConvertToSqlString(StringList):
+ return map(lambda s: "'" + s.replace("'", "''") + "'", StringList)
+
+## TableFile
+#
+# This class defined a common table
+#
+# @param object: Inherited from object class
+#
+# @param Cursor: Cursor of the database
+# @param TableName: Name of the table
+#
+class Table(object):
+ _COLUMN_ = ''
+ _ID_STEP_ = 1
+ _ID_MAX_ = 0x80000000
+ _DUMMY_ = 0
+
+ def __init__(self, Cursor, Name='', IdBase=0, Temporary=False):
+ self.Cur = Cursor
+ self.Table = Name
+ self.IdBase = int(IdBase)
+ self.ID = int(IdBase)
+ self.Temporary = Temporary
+
+ def __str__(self):
+ return self.Table
+
+ ## Create table
+ #
+ # Create a table
+ #
+ def Create(self, NewTable=True):
+ if NewTable:
+ self.Drop()
+
+ if self.Temporary:
+ SqlCommand = """create temp table IF NOT EXISTS %s (%s)""" % (self.Table, self._COLUMN_)
+ else:
+ SqlCommand = """create table IF NOT EXISTS %s (%s)""" % (self.Table, self._COLUMN_)
+ EdkLogger.debug(EdkLogger.DEBUG_8, SqlCommand)
+ self.Cur.execute(SqlCommand)
+ self.ID = self.GetId()
+
+ ## Insert table
+ #
+ # Insert a record into a table
+ #
+ def Insert(self, *Args):
+ self.ID = self.ID + self._ID_STEP_
+ if self.ID >= (self.IdBase + self._ID_MAX_):
+ self.ID = self.IdBase + self._ID_STEP_
+ Values = ", ".join([str(Arg) for Arg in Args])
+ SqlCommand = "insert into %s values(%s, %s)" % (self.Table, self.ID, Values)
+ EdkLogger.debug(EdkLogger.DEBUG_5, SqlCommand)
+ self.Cur.execute(SqlCommand)
+ return self.ID
+
+ ## Query table
+ #
+ # Query all records of the table
+ #
+ def Query(self):
+ SqlCommand = """select * from %s""" % self.Table
+ self.Cur.execute(SqlCommand)
+ for Rs in self.Cur:
+ EdkLogger.verbose(str(Rs))
+ TotalCount = self.GetId()
+
+ ## Drop a table
+ #
+ # Drop the table
+ #
+ def Drop(self):
+ SqlCommand = """drop table IF EXISTS %s""" % self.Table
+ self.Cur.execute(SqlCommand)
+
+ ## Get count
+ #
+ # Get a count of all records of the table
+ #
+ # @retval Count: Total count of all records
+ #
+ def GetCount(self):
+ SqlCommand = """select count(ID) from %s""" % self.Table
+ Record = self.Cur.execute(SqlCommand).fetchall()
+ return Record[0][0]
+
+ def GetId(self):
+ SqlCommand = """select max(ID) from %s""" % self.Table
+ Record = self.Cur.execute(SqlCommand).fetchall()
+ Id = Record[0][0]
+ if Id == None:
+ Id = self.IdBase
+ return Id
+
+ ## Init the ID of the table
+ #
+ # Init the ID of the table
+ #
+ def InitID(self):
+ self.ID = self.GetId()
+
+ ## Exec
+ #
+ # Exec Sql Command, return result
+ #
+ # @param SqlCommand: The SqlCommand to be executed
+ #
+ # @retval RecordSet: The result after executed
+ #
+ def Exec(self, SqlCommand):
+ EdkLogger.debug(EdkLogger.DEBUG_5, SqlCommand)
+ self.Cur.execute(SqlCommand)
+ RecordSet = self.Cur.fetchall()
+ return RecordSet
+
+ def SetEndFlag(self):
+ self.Exec("insert into %s values(%s)" % (self.Table, self._DUMMY_))
+ #
+ # Need to execution commit for table data changed.
+ #
+ self.Cur.connection.commit()
+
+ def IsIntegral(self):
+ Result = self.Exec("select min(ID) from %s" % (self.Table))
+ if Result[0][0] != -1:
+ return False
+ return True
+
+ def GetAll(self):
+ return self.Exec("select * from %s where ID > 0 order by ID" % (self.Table))

+## TableFile
+#
+# This class defined a table used for file
+#
+# @param object: Inherited from object class
+#
+class TableFile(Table):
+ _COLUMN_ = '''
+ ID INTEGER PRIMARY KEY,
+ Name VARCHAR NOT NULL,
+ ExtName VARCHAR,
+ Path VARCHAR,
+ FullPath VARCHAR NOT NULL,
+ Model INTEGER DEFAULT 0,
+ TimeStamp SINGLE NOT NULL
+ '''
+ def __init__(self, Cursor):
+ Table.__init__(self, Cursor, 'File')
+
+ ## Insert table
+ #
+ # Insert a record into table File
+ #
+ # @param Name: Name of a File
+ # @param ExtName: ExtName of a File
+ # @param Path: Path of a File
+ # @param FullPath: FullPath of a File
+ # @param Model: Model of a File
+ # @param TimeStamp: TimeStamp of a File
+ #
+ def Insert(self, Name, ExtName, Path, FullPath, Model, TimeStamp):
+ (Name, ExtName, Path, FullPath) = ConvertToSqlString((Name, ExtName, Path, FullPath))
+ return Table.Insert(
+ self,
+ Name,
+ ExtName,
+ Path,
+ FullPath,
+ Model,
+ TimeStamp
+ )
+
+ ## InsertFile
+ #
+ # Insert one file to table
+ #
+ # @param FileFullPath: The full path of the file
+ # @param Model: The model of the file
+ #
+ # @retval FileID: The ID after record is inserted
+ #
+ def InsertFile(self, File, Model):
+ return self.Insert(
+ File.Name,
+ File.Ext,
+ File.Dir,
+ File.Path,
+ Model,
+ File.TimeStamp
+ )
+
+ ## Get ID of a given file
+ #
+ # @param FilePath Path of file
+ #
+ # @retval ID ID value of given file in the table
+ #
+ def GetFileId(self, File):
+ QueryScript = "select ID from %s where FullPath = '%s'" % (self.Table, str(File))
+ RecordList = self.Exec(QueryScript)
+ if len(RecordList) == 0:
+ return None
+ return RecordList[0][0]
+
+ ## Get type of a given file
+ #
+ # @param FileId ID of a file
+ #
+ # @retval file_type Model value of given file in the table
+ #
+ def GetFileType(self, FileId):
+ QueryScript = "select Model from %s where ID = '%s'" % (self.Table, FileId)
+ RecordList = self.Exec(QueryScript)
+ if len(RecordList) == 0:
+ return None
+ return RecordList[0][0]
+
+ ## Get file timestamp of a given file
+ #
+ # @param FileId ID of file
+ #
+ # @retval timestamp TimeStamp value of given file in the table
+ #
+ def GetFileTimeStamp(self, FileId):
+ QueryScript = "select TimeStamp from %s where ID = '%s'" % (self.Table, FileId)
+ RecordList = self.Exec(QueryScript)
+ if len(RecordList) == 0:
+ return None
+ return RecordList[0][0]
+
+ ## Update the timestamp of a given file
+ #
+ # @param FileId ID of file
+ # @param TimeStamp Time stamp of file
+ #
+ def SetFileTimeStamp(self, FileId, TimeStamp):
+ self.Exec("update %s set TimeStamp=%s where ID='%s'" % (self.Table, TimeStamp, FileId))
+
+ ## Get list of file with given type
+ #
+ # @param FileType Type value of file
+ #
+ # @retval file_list List of files with the given type
+ #
+ def GetFileList(self, FileType):
+ RecordList = self.Exec("select FullPath from %s where Model=%s" % (self.Table, FileType))
+ if len(RecordList) == 0:
+ return []
+ return [R[0] for R in RecordList]
+
+## TableDataModel
+#
+# This class defined a table used for data model
+#
+# @param object: Inherited from object class
+#
+#
+class TableDataModel(Table):
+ _COLUMN_ = """
+ ID INTEGER PRIMARY KEY,
+ CrossIndex INTEGER NOT NULL,
+ Name VARCHAR NOT NULL,
+ Description VARCHAR
+ """
+ def __init__(self, Cursor):
+ Table.__init__(self, Cursor, 'DataModel')
+
+ ## Insert table
+ #
+ # Insert a record into table DataModel
+ #
+ # @param ID: ID of a ModelType
+ # @param CrossIndex: CrossIndex of a ModelType
+ # @param Name: Name of a ModelType
+ # @param Description: Description of a ModelType
+ #
+ def Insert(self, CrossIndex, Name, Description):
+ (Name, Description) = ConvertToSqlString((Name, Description))
+ return Table.Insert(self, CrossIndex, Name, Description)
+
+ ## Init table
+ #
+ # Create all default records of table DataModel
+ #
+ def InitTable(self):
+ EdkLogger.verbose("\nInitialize table DataModel started ...")
+ Count = self.GetCount()
+ if Count != None and Count != 0:
+ return
+ for Item in DataClass.MODEL_LIST:
+ CrossIndex = Item[1]
+ Name = Item[0]
+ Description = Item[0]
+ self.Insert(CrossIndex, Name, Description)
+ EdkLogger.verbose("Initialize table DataModel ... DONE!")
+
+ ## Get CrossIndex
+ #
+ # Get a model's cross index from its name
+ #
+ # @param ModelName: Name of the model
+ # @retval CrossIndex: CrossIndex of the model
+ #
+ def GetCrossIndex(self, ModelName):
+ CrossIndex = -1
+ SqlCommand = """select CrossIndex from DataModel where name = '""" + ModelName + """'"""
+ self.Cur.execute(SqlCommand)
+ for Item in self.Cur:
+ CrossIndex = Item[0]
+
+ return CrossIndex
